Unraveling the Comet’s Mysterious Origins in the Icy Oort Cloud
The comet in question hails from the Oort Cloud, a distant and largely unexplored region of our solar system that lies at the very edge of the Sun’s gravitational influence. This icy repository of comets and other celestial bodies has long been a source of fascination for astronomers, and the emergence of this particular comet has only heightened their curiosity.

According to experts, the Oort Cloud is believed to be a vast, spherical shell of icy objects that orbits the Sun at distances ranging from 2,000 to 200,000 times the distance between the Earth and the Sun. It is thought to be the source of many of the long-period comets that occasionally grace our skies, but the details of its composition and structure remain largely a mystery.
